An app called Haptik just made Father’s Day especially fun for everyone, not just dads. The app, which acts as a personal assistant you can chat with, set up a grumpy old Indian papa assistance bot.

So for whatever you ask the bot – aptly called ‘The Baap’ – there’s an angry daddy rejoinder from the app.

From a constant volley of suspicious questions, to complaining you do no work, the app really seems to have captured the essence of a stereotypical Indian dad. Except it’s funny and not infuriating when this Baap, and not your own, picks on you.
